WebAug 23, 2024 · A .gitignore file is a plain text file where each line contains a pattern for files/directories to ignore. Generally, this is placed in the root folder of the repository, and that's what I recommend. However, you can put it in any folder in the repository and you can also have multiple .gitignore files. WebIf you have dist in your ignore file, all files and folders named dist in the same directory as the ignore file and in all subdirectories recursively are ignored.. If you have dist/ in your ignore file, all folders but not files named dist in the same directory as the ignore file and in all subdirectories recursively are ignored.. If you ignore files by using a pattern but have exceptions, prefix an exclamation mark (!) to the exception. For example: *.txt !important.txt. The above example instructs Git to ignore all files with the .txt extension except for files named important.txt. WebJan 17, 2024 · To ignore a previously committed file, first unstage it and remove it from the index, then add the following rule to your .gitignore file: git rm --cached filename The --cached option instructs git to remove the file from the index rather than the working tree. WebSep 19, 2024 · The easiest and most common way to ignore files is to use a gitignore file. Simply create a file named .gitignore in the repository’s root directory. Then, add names and patterns for any files and directories that should not be added to the repository.
